Phebe Howe 1786–1871 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 16 October 1786

Birth Location: Massachusetts, United States of America

Death Date: 28 April 1871

Death Location: Reading Center, Schuyler County, New York, United States of America

Father: Timothy Howe

Mother: Keziah Powers

Spouse(s): Garret Herring

Children(s): Kesia Herring, Anna Haring, Chancey Haring, Chester Haring, Clarisa Haring, Deborah Haring, Harriet Haring, Isaac Haring, John Haring, Polly Haring, William Haring, Cornelia Haring

Phebe Howe was born in 1786 in Massachusetts, United States of America, the child of Timothy Howe And Keziah Powers. In 1850, Phebe Howe resided in Orange, Steuben, New York, USA. Phebe Howe married Garret Herring, and had children including Anna Biancy Haring, Chancey Haring, Chester Haring, Clarisa Haring, Cornelia Haring, Deborah Pamelia Haring, Harriet Marshal Haring, Isaac Howe Haring, John Haring, Kesia Herring, Polly Haring, William Haring. Phebe Howe passed away in 1871 in Reading Center, Schuyler County, New York, United States of America.
